Heya folks...just spent an enjoyable morning surfing the forums here, but haven't been able to come up with a solution for my problem:

I've been testing GameEx out on an old laptop of mine and have been able to get MAME and other emulator ROMs working. With high hopes, I moved everything over to a desktop that will be my cabinet's system. It's an AMD system with 512k ram and an ATI 9800 PRO running Win XP PRO. I am using S-Video out to run a signal to my home TV. Resolution is 800x600...

Problem is: I can load up GameEx and update my ROM list, but when I attempt to load any game in MAME, the screen goes black for a second and then quits right back to the GameEx screen. This is happening on a whole host of games..not all vert. oriented (I think, tried on congo bongo, Teenage mutant ninja turtles and others).

Anyway..I played around with GameEx some more last night and managed to fix the problem!! I erased the versions of MAME32 and AdvanceMAME I had on the computer and went straight to the homepages of each and downloaded fresh copies.

I was having a problem when I only had MAME32 installed that GameEx wasn't listing it on the Start screen? But this was resolved when I noticed that GameEx was looking for Advance MAME (Even though I had MAME32 setup in the GameEx wizard??). After I downloaded AdvanceMAME as well, MAME showed back up in the GameEx start screen.

BUT...I think the big problem was my screen resolution. I had my res. set to 800X600 and decided to see what happened if I set my resolution lower. When I dropped it to 640X?? all of a sudden MAME works perfectly!!!

You can turn off StickyKeys by selecting Start->Settings->Control Panel->Accessibility Options

Then under the Keyboard tab take away the tick next to "Use StickyKeys".
